While many of those skills are fun to learn, the most important survival skills iare to learn how to stay safe, stay found, and get out. Most of the skills on your list become pretty darn redundant at that point.

I think too many people endorse the idea of the outdoors as survival training. It's recreation. Get out there, have fun, and stay safe. You don't need to know how to catch a fish with your bare hands, skin a bear, or make a fire in the blizzard to have a spectacularly good time in the wilderness.
